Berlin's Views & Modern Architecture

Berlin’s skyline is defined by a blend of historic domes and pioneering 20th-century architecture. This collection features iconic structures like the 368-meter Fernsehturm and the glass-domed Reichstag, alongside modernist landmarks designed by Mies van der Rohe and Le Corbusier. The selection also highlights UNESCO-listed housing estates from the Weimar Republic and unconventional vantage points such as the man-made Teufelsberg hill and the Neukölln rooftop garden, Klunkerkranich. These locations provide a detailed perspective on the city's architectural history and urban landscape.

Reichstag Building A

Reichstag Building

Historic government building housing the German Bundestag, featuring a large glass dome and roof terrace with panoramic views.

Berlin TV Tower B

Berlin TV Tower

A 368-meter tall communication and observation tower featuring a distinctive spherical design and modern architecture.

Panoramapoint C

Panoramapoint

Observation deck on Kollhoff Tower offering 360° panoramic views of the city, a café, and an exhibition on local history.

Berlin Cathedral D

Berlin Cathedral

Historic Protestant cathedral renowned for its neo-baroque and renaissance revival architecture, featuring a large dome and cultural significance as a Prussian heritage site.

Berlin Philharmonic E

Berlin Philharmonic

Modern concert hall known for its distinctive architecture and renowned acoustics, serving as a home for classical music performances and cultural events.

French Cathedral F

French Cathedral

The French Church of Friedrichstadt is in Berlin at the Gendarmenmarkt, across the Konzerthaus and the German Cathedral.

Radio Tower Berlin G

Radio Tower Berlin

At first look similar to Eiffel Tower, this tower is nicknamed "langer Lulatsch", meaning lanky lad.

New National Gallery H

New National Gallery

This building in a square shape was designed by the famous functionalist architect Ludwig Mies van der Rohe. Modern art is showcased here.

Potsdamer Platz I

Potsdamer Platz

Historic public square featuring modern skyscrapers and architecture, known for its significant World War II history and post-reunification redevelopment.

Teufelsberg J

Teufelsberg

Rising up to 80 meters, this man-made hill was created after World War II from the debris of Berlin's destroyed buildings.

Le Corbusier House K

Le Corbusier House

Unité d'Habitation of Berlin is a 1958 apartment building located in Berlin-Westend, Germany, designed by Le Corbusier following his…

Kino International L

Kino International

During the GDR era, this used to be the cinema number one of the city.

Tempodrom M

Tempodrom

The Tempodrom is a multi-purpose event venue in Berlin.

Klunkerkranich N

Klunkerkranich

Rooftop bar and cultural garden situated atop a multi-story parking garage in Neukölln, providing wide-ranging views of the city skyline.

Falkenberg Garden City O

Falkenberg Garden City

A UNESCO World Heritage site and a staple of progressive Berlin architecture from the times of the Weimar Republic.

Siedlung Schillerpark P

Siedlung Schillerpark

UNESCO World Heritage site and an outstanding example of modern architecture. Open and well-lit flats are complemented by the brick facade.
